Ajmal Kasab's execution: Nobody in cabinet knew, Shinde tells NDTV

New Delhi: Home Minister Sushil Kumar Shinde, in an exclusive interview to NDTV, says even the Cabinet did not know about the execution of 26/11 terrorist Ajmal Kasab till the time it was flashed on TV channels. Here are the highlights of his interview:

  • The UPA President was not a part of this decision
  • The Congress top leadership or Cabinet not involved. This is department's work
  • The file came on November 5 but I was in Rome for a Interpol meeting. I saw it on November 7
  • The file said that the President had refused his mercy petition
  • On October 16, I signed the file to send it to be President without remarks. The remarks being that Kasab should be hanged
  • It is my routine work. It is my nature to keep work a secret. I have a police background
  • None of my cabinet colleagues knew. PM, others got to know from TV this morning
  • We did not call this Operation X. I don't know where that term came from
